linux终端复制命令结果

不及物动词 其他 149

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ux终端中,要复制命令的结果,有多种方法可以使用。以下是一些常见的方式:

    1. 使用复制命令:
    在执行命令时,可以使用`|`操作符将命令结果传递给复制命令。例如,要复制ls命令的结果,可以执行以下命令:
    “`
    ls | pbcopy // macOS
    ls | xclip -selection clipboard // Ubuntu/Linux Mint
    ls | xsel -ib // Ubuntu/Linux Mint
    “`
    这样,命令结果将被复制到剪贴板中。然后,您可以使用粘贴命令将结果粘贴到其他地方。

    2. 使用重定向操作符:
    可以使用重定向操作符将命令的输出保存到文件中,然后复制该文件。
    “`
    ls > result.txt
    “`
    这将把ls命令的输出保存到result.txt文件中。然后,您可以打开该文件并复制其中的内容。

    3. 使用截屏工具:
    如果您需要复制终端中的大块内容,您可以使用截屏工具来截取终端窗口的屏幕截图。然后,您可以打开截图并复制所需部分。

    4. 使用鼠标选择和复制:
    大多数Linux终端仿真器支持鼠标选择和复制文本的功能。您可以使用鼠标选择要复制的命令结果并使用右键菜单或快捷键进行复制操作。

    请注意,具体的方法可能会因不同的Linux发行版和终端仿真器而有所不同。您可以根据自己的情况选择最适合您的方法来复制命令的结果。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ux终端中,复制命令的结果可以通过多种方式实现。下面列出了五种常见的方法:

    1. 使用Ctrl + Shift + C:在终端上选择要复制的命令结果,然后按下Ctrl + Shift + C组合键。这将把选择的内容复制到剪贴板中。您可以在任何其他应用程序中使用Ctrl + V粘贴它。

    2. 使用鼠标右键菜单:在终端上选择要复制的命令结果,然后使用鼠标右键点击选择的内容。在弹出的菜单中选择“复制”选项。这将把选择的内容复制到剪贴板中。您可以在任何其他应用程序中使用Ctrl + V粘贴它。

    3. 使用管道操作符(|):如果您在命令行上使用了管道操作符(|)将一个命令的输出传递给另一个命令,您可以使用重定向符(>)将输出复制到一个文件中。例如,要将命令ls的输出复制到一个文件中,可以使用以下命令:ls > output.txt。这将把命令的结果保存到一个名为output.txt的文件中。

    4. 使用xclip命令:如果您安装了xclip程序,可以使用它来复制终端中的内容。要使用xclip命令,首先安装该程序(可以使用软件包管理器)。然后使用以下命令将命令结果复制到剪贴板中:your-command | xclip -selection clipboard。将your-command替换为您要复制结果的实际命令。

    5. 使用tmux或screen会话:如果您正在使用tmux或screen程序进行多个终端会话,可以使用其内置的复制和粘贴功能复制终端中的内容。具体的步骤会略有不同,但通常是使用快捷键将选择的内容复制到终端会话的剪贴板中,然后在其他会话中使用快捷键将剪贴板的内容粘贴出来。这个方法尤其适用于需要在不同的终端会话中共享命令结果的情况。

    总之,在Linux终端中复制命令结果有多种方法可供选择,您可以根据自己的需要和偏好选择最适合您的方法。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ux终端中,有几种方法可以复制命令的结果。下面将介绍三种常用的方法:使用重定向、使用管道和使用剪贴板。

    1. 使用重定向:
    重定向是将命令的输出结果输出到文件中。可以将输出结果复制到剪贴板或者从文件中读取输出结果然后复制。
    首先,使用下面的命令将命令的输出结果保存到一个文件中:
    命令 > 文件名

    例如,如果要复制 `ls` 命令的输出结果,可以使用以下命令:

    “`
    ls > output.txt
    “`

    然后,可以使用`cat`命令来查看文件的内容:

    “`
    cat output.txt
    “`

    将文件内容复制到剪贴板中,可以使用`xclip`命令:

    “`
    cat output.txt | xclip -selection clipboard
    “`

    现在,你可以在其他地方使用剪贴板中的内容粘贴。

    2. 使用管道:
    管道是将一个命令的输出结果作为另一个命令的输入。可以使用管道将命令的输出结果复制到剪贴板。
    首先,使用下面的命令将命令的输出结果通过管道传递给`xclip`命令:

    “`
    命令 | xclip -selection clipboard
    “`

    例如,要复制`ls`命令的输出结果,可以使用以下命令:

    “`
    ls | xclip -selection clipboard
    “`

    现在,你可以在其他地方使用剪贴板中的内容粘贴。

    3. 使用剪贴板:
    Linux终端也支持使用剪贴板复制命令的输出结果。可以使用xclip命令将命令的输出结果直接复制到剪贴板。
    首先,安装xclip命令:

    “`
    sudo apt-get install xclip
    “`

    然后,使用以下命令将命令的输出结果复制到剪贴板:

    “`
    命令 | xclip -selection clipboard
    “`

    例如,要复制`ls`命令的输出结果,可以使用以下命令:

    “`
    ls | xclip -selection clipboard
    “`

    现在,你可以在其他地方使用剪贴板中的内容粘贴。

    以上是在Linux终端中复制命令结果的三种常用方法。你可以根据实际情况选择其中一种方法来复制命令的输出结果。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部